Marlene Mhangami gave a keynote over remote video here at #pyconafrica2024. Her presentation of some (quoted) grand claims about AI reminded me of the term's origin > On September 2, 1955, the project was formally proposed by [John] McCarthy, Marvin Minsky, Nathaniel Rochester and Claude Shannon. The proposal is credited with introducing the term 'artificial intelligence'. > We propose that a 2-month, 10-man study of artificial intelligence be carried out during the summer of 1956 [...] The study is to proceed on the basis of the conjecture that every aspect of learning or any other feature of intelligence can in principle be so precisely described that a machine can be made to simulate it. [...] We think that a significant advance can be made in one or more of these problems if a carefully selected group of scientists work on it together for a summer. Marlene Mhangami #pyconafrica24

📢 We are delighted to announce the publication of the inaugural article of the ACM Transactions on Autonomous and Adaptive Systems (TAAS) Editor’s Special Collection Series. Generative AI for Self-Adaptive Systems: State of the Art and Research Roadmap, By: Jialong Li, Mingyue Zhang, Nianyu Li, Danny Weyns, Zhi Jin, and Kenji Tei This article provides researchers and practitioners a comprehensive snapshot that outlines the potential benefits and challenges of employing GenAI’s within self-adaptive systems (SASs). It draws a research roadmap that starts with outlining key research challenges that need to be tackled to exploit the potential for applying GenAI in the field of SAS, and concludes with a practical reflection, elaborating on current shortcomings of GenAI and proposing possible mitigation strategies. GenAI is rapidly becoming a game-changer in the creative process, enhancing our ability to efficiently search, summarise and refine work. Agentic systems are pushing the boundaries even further, transforming the traditional back-and-forth of chat into a dynamic web of intelligent agents that perform complex tasks with humans remaining firmly in control. Just a few days ago, Sakana unveiled a significant development: The AI Scientist https://lnkd.in/gWdJagty — the first system capable of fully autonomous scientific discovery. This innovative platform can independently navigate the entire research lifecycle — from generating novel ideas and writing code to executing experiments, summarising results and presenting its findings in a polished scientific paper. The system can produce a full research paper at a cost of only $15. What does this mean for the future of research? Are we on the brink of a surge in published papers? And while automating the research lifecycle sounds promising, could it potentially undermine the creative spark that drives true innovation?
